We have modeled and optimized TN‐TFT‐LCDS with novel film compensation methods, appropriate liquid crystal materials, and cell designs to achieve extremely wide viewing angles required for desktop and avionics applications. We have built such TN‐TFT‐LCDs, measured their optical performance, and confirmed the very large usable viewing volume. The optimized TN‐TFT‐LCDS show a 30:1 contrast ratio beyond +/− 80° in the horizontal direction and beyond −35° and +55° in the vertical direction. Measurements have also been taken for in‐plane switch (IPS) mode TFT‐LCDS and the results will be compared to our newly developed wide viewing angle TN‐TFT‐LCDS.
